Frequently Asked Questions About Roofing in Holden

Get answers to common questions about roofing services in Holden, Missouri.

1What is the typical cost range for a new asphalt shingle roof on an average-sized home in Holden?

For a typical 2,000-2,500 square foot home in Holden, a complete asphalt shingle roof replacement generally ranges from $8,500 to $15,000. The final cost depends on roof complexity, the specific quality of shingles (important for Missouri's variable weather), and the cost of removing the old roof. Local material availability and labor rates in the Johnson County area directly influence this pricing.

2When is the best time of year to schedule a roof replacement in Holden, Missouri?

The ideal windows are late spring (May-June) and early fall (September-October). These periods typically offer the mild, dry weather needed for proper installation, avoiding the intense summer heat that can make shingles too pliable and the icy, unpredictable conditions of a Missouri winter. Scheduling early in these seasons is key, as reputable local roofers' calendars fill up quickly.

3Are there specific roofing materials better suited for Holden's climate?

Yes. Given Missouri's potential for severe storms with hail, high winds, and temperature swings, impact-resistant asphalt shingles (rated Class 3 or 4) are a highly recommended investment. These shingles are specifically tested to withstand hail and can also lead to potential discounts on homeowners insurance. Proper attic ventilation is also crucial to combat Midwest humidity and heat.

4What should I look for when choosing a roofing contractor in Holden?

Always verify the contractor is licensed and insured in Missouri. Choose a roofer with a strong local reputation in Holden and surrounding areas, as they understand regional weather challenges and building codes. Request proof of local references and physical business address, and ensure they provide a detailed, written estimate and warranty covering both materials and workmanship.

5Do I need a permit to replace my roof in Holden, and how does hail damage affect the process?

Yes, the City of Holden requires a building permit for a full roof replacement to ensure it meets current building codes. A reputable local roofer will typically handle this process. For hail damage, it's common to work with your insurance company. Have a professional inspection first, as damage can be subtle, and use a contractor experienced in navigating insurance claims specific to Missouri storm events.
